For a standard efficiency (80% AFUE) furnace replacement in a Swartz Creek home, homeowners can expect to pay between $4,500 and $7,000, while high-efficiency (90%+ AFUE) models typically range from $6,500 to $10,000+. Key factors include the unit's size (BTU output) needed for our cold Michigan winters, the complexity of installation in your existing ductwork, and the brand/features selected. Always get a detailed, written estimate that includes removal of the old unit, all labor, and materials.
The ideal times are during the "shoulder seasons"—late spring (April-May) for AC service and early fall (September-October) for furnace service. Scheduling during these periods ensures your system is ready for Michigan's extreme summer heat and winter cold, and you'll avoid the high-demand rush and potential emergency fees. For replacements, planning ahead in these windows also provides more installer availability and potential off-season promotions.
While Swartz Creek follows Michigan's statewide mechanical code, all HVAC contractors must be licensed by the State of Michigan (look for a license number). Importantly, Consumers Energy and DTE Energy offer significant rebates for Swartz Creek residents who install qualifying high-efficiency furnaces, air conditioners, and heat pumps. Your local HVAC provider should be knowledgeable about these programs and help you with the application to offset your upfront costs.
Prioritize local, established companies with strong community reputations, as they understand our specific climate challenges. Verify they hold a valid State of Michigan license and carry both liability insurance and worker's compensation. Ask for references from recent installations in the area and check online reviews specific to their service in Genesee County. A trustworthy contractor will perform a detailed load calculation for your home, not just recommend the same size unit you already have.
It is normal for your AC to run more frequently during peak summer heat, especially during our humid stretches. However, if it's running non-stop without adequately cooling your home or achieving the thermostat setpoint, it indicates a problem. Common local issues include low refrigerant levels, a dirty condenser coil (from pollen and yard debris), or an undersized unit. Persistent cycling can lead to system failure and high energy bills, so a professional diagnostic is recommended.
